RECUERDA QUE EN PRESENTE SIMPLE CUANDO HABLAMOS DE EL O ELLA (HE/SHE) EN EL AFIRMATIVO VA EL VERBO CON S Y EN EL NEGATIVO USAMOS DOESN´T MAS EL VERBO PERO SIN LA S ABAJO ESTA EL CUADRO EXPLICATIVO DE LOS CASOS EN QUE CAMBIAN ALGUNAS TERMINACIONES.

-CUANDO LA LETRA ANTERIOR A LA “Y” ES CONSONANTE CAMBIA A “IES”

- CUANDO EL VERBO TERMINA EN CH/SH/O/S/X SE LE AGREGA “ES”

-VERBO HAVE PASA A “HAS”
